The Rise of Counter-Strike 2
Counter-Strike has always been a popular force in the gaming world, but its recent update, Counter-Strike 2, is launching things to a whole new level. Players are flocking to the revamped maps, embracing the enhanced visuals, and getting their hands on all the updated weapons and gameplay mechanics.
The developers at Valve have definitely put a lot of effort into making Counter-Strike 2 a truly next-generation experience, and it's clear in every aspect of the game. From the improved graphics to the tightened gameplay, Counter-Strike 2 is setting a new standard for FPS games. With its expanding player base and overwhelmingly positive reception, it's safe to say that Counter-Strike 2 is here to stay.
